 Description of the problemThe brake actuator malfunctioned and the brakes began pulsating and groaning when applied. This happened on the baltimore washington parkway. Braking power was greatly reduced and i had to coast to a stop in the shoulder of the highway and slowly make my way to an exit ramp as it was too unsafe to continue driving at speed and i was worried that the car was a danger to myself and other drivers in that condition. The brakes would pulsate/groan whenever the car was in drive and they were applied. When i took the car to a toyota dealer for servicing two days later (i did not drive the car at all in the interim), they told me that there was a problem with the actuator and that it would need to be replaced. This cost $2156. I had replaced the brake rotors, pads, and had a brake fluid flush completed just 2 months before in this vehicle. From the documents on file with nhtsa, my incident appears to be a common problem with this make/model/year car. As this could have easily caused an accident, i believe toyota should be responsible for ensuring that the actuator is recalled and that others are not put into the same, potentially dangerous, situation.
